Simulation Types
Standard E-commerce
Simulates typical online shopping behavior with product browsing, cart management, and purchase completion. Includes abandoned cart scenarios and return visitors.
High-Traffic Event
Models traffic spikes during sales events, product launches, or marketing campaigns. Tests system performance under load with realistic user behavior patterns.
Mobile-First
Focuses on mobile user journeys with app-like behavior, including deep links, push notification responses, and mobile-specific conversion patterns.
B2B Commerce
Simulates business buyer behavior with bulk orders, quote requests, and longer decision cycles. Includes multi-stakeholder approval workflows.
Best Practices
- Start with lower traffic volumes to validate your setup
- Use realistic conversion rates based on your industry benchmarks
- Test edge cases like payment failures and cart abandonment
- Monitor destination health during high-volume simulations
- Save successful configurations as templates for future use
